Eliphaz Fay (April 27, 1797 – March 19, 1854) served as the fourth president of Colby College (then called the Waterville College) in Maine.
[3] He married Mary Helen (Lee) on April 20, 1829.
[2] His children were Susan Mary, William Wirt, Henry Harrison, Caroline Louise.
[1] From 1833-1834 he published The Independence, a newspaper in Poughkeepsie, New York, which "advocate(d) the cause of Anti-Masonry, literature, science, temperance, morality and religion."
[4] Elected President of Colby College in August 1841, after a year when the college had no president for the prior year.
